INNOVATIVE EDUCATIONAL ENVIRONMENT AS A SPACE FOR DEVELOPING LEADERSHIP QUALITIES IN FUTURE MANAGERS AND ENTREPRENEURS

The article explores the concept of an innovative educational environment as a key factor in preparing competitive specialists in the fields of management and entrepreneurship. It analyzes modern approaches to the development of leadership qualities in higher education students, particularly in the context of the integration of education, science, and business. The role of digital technologies, interdisciplinary learning, gamification, mentorship, and project-based activities in developing leadership competencies is discussed. The importance of fostering innovative thinking, strategic vision, emotional intelligence, and communication flexibility as components of effective leadership is emphasized. Special attention is given to examples of the implementation of innovative educational practices in higher education institutions that ensure close interaction with the real business environment. The author justifies the need for the transformation of traditional educational models in line with the needs of the 21st-century labor market to successfully prepare the new generation of managers and entrepreneurs.
